Two parcels, totaling 100 acres, are within the renowned To Kalon Vineyard. These are complemented by the combined 70 acres of the Ballestra and River parcels, which envelop the winery. In the vineyards, hand-harvesting and other traditional approaches are taken wherever they work best.An effective to do manager. ![]() The estate vineyards of Opus One, comprised of four parcels, sit in the western portion of the famed Oakville AVA in Napa Valley. It remains an ongoing testament to the founders’ vision of a singular wine that transcends generations. Rising gracefully from the vineyards, Opus One winery stands in subtle celebration of the land and the open space that surrounds the estate. Guided by the vision of our founders, winemaker Michael Silacci combines intuition and technical acumen with the dual perspective of viticulturist and winemaker. From tasting berries to careful sorting and extended aging in new French oak barrels, each stage of the winemaking process is afforded the same meticulous consideration and attention. After 18 months, the Opus One wine is bottled and held an additional 15 months until release on October 1st each year. Place, often defined as terroir, represents the geography, the climate and the essential human element which is captured in the wine’s balance between power and finesse, structure and texture. The essence of time is expressed in Opus One wine by the character of each vintage. The facial profile of the two founders is visible on their iconic label. Producing luxury wines from its Napa Valley vineyards, the partnership made its first vintage in 1979 and has made wine at Opus One since 1991. Opus One is a partnership founded by Baron Philippe de Rothschild of Chateau Mouton Rothschild in Pauillac, France, and renowned Napa Valley vintner, Robert Mondavi. Rolling for passion (two flames) is just as important as rolling for a high skill, because they will level up faster. Stay away from colonists incapable of many tasks, especially dumb labour. Remember, your characters can only do one thing at a time and they need time to eat and sleep. You can click randomize on your colonists as many times as you want. A mountain base is also a good option, it's easy to defend and will give you plenty of stone chunks, but takes longer to dig in the beginning and tend to suffer from bug infestations later on. Large hills have plenty of ores and hills to build against. Small hills have more ores but the hills still do not provide much protection. Flat terrain lack ores to mine and is difficult to defend. You will also want to pay attention to the terrain type. You want a map with a growing season that lasts from at least spring to fall, if not all year. You should pick a temperate forest biome to start. The default dimensions is a good size that won't cause too much lag. You can play with the seed and map size of the world, but it isn't anything that will make a big difference to you yet. It is recommended to choose Cassandra Classic on Rough to get a feel for how the game is designed to play out. The AI Storytellers only determine the random events that occur during your game. You can pick a storyteller and a difficulty level. This guide assumes that you're choosing the classic "three crashlanded survivors" scenario. The resulting " United States Strategic Bombing Survey " concluded that the bombing had mixed levels of success. War a committee of American industrial experts was asked to produce an impartial assessment of the effectiveness of the Allied bombingĬampaign on German industry. The second major purpose behind the Allies massive air bombing campaign was to cripple key German war industries. Germans discovered during the London "Blitz", the bombing stiffened German resistance instead of weakening it. Thousands of German civilians and the incredible destructiveness of the firestorms shocked the Nazi leadership. The destruction caused hardship to hundreds of The aim of the offensive was to break the morale of the German people. Which resulted in high civil casualties were Swinemuende (23,000 dead), Pforzheim (21,200 dead), Darmstadt (12,300 dead), and Kassel In each case, a series of co-ordinated raids created a firestorm and left tens of thousands dead. The most destructive raids in terms of casualties were those on Hamburg (45,000 dead) in 1943 and Dresden At its worst this combination could burn out an entire city center in one night, ![]() Out the massive fires caused by the incendiaries. The high explosives destroyed water supplies and water lines preventing firemen from putting A combination of massive "blockbuster" bombs and incendiaries New methods were introduced to increase the destruction. Two further 1,000 bomber raids were executed over Essen and Bremen, but to less effect than the destructionĪt Cologne. 411 civilians and 85 combatants were killed, more than 130,000 "Operation Millenium", the first "1,000 bomber raid" when 1,046 aircraft bombed Cologne, dropping over 2,000 tons of highĮxplosive and incendiaries and burning the city from end to end. Indiscriminately destroying everything for kilometres around in every direction. In practice what this meant was that 200 to 1000 aircraft would mass "carpet" bomb a German industrial area or city center, The first was stated in the February, 1942 Bomber Command "Area Bombing Directive".īomber Command was to target German industrial sites with the additional aim of attacking the morale of German industrial workers. As a resultĪllied planners adopted two bombing strategies. On some missions the entire bombing group dropped their bombs on the wrong location. A USAAF study estimated that less than ten percent of bombs fell withinĨ kms of the intended target. High altitude mass bombing was extremely inaccurate. Before Unicode was created, everyone had their own ways of storing and presenting text, and so whenever two programs from different programmers or organizations had to "talk" to each other, they had a " Translator "so that they could understand which codes refer to which textual characters. Unicode is an international standards body that works towards a universal specification for text characters. In the early days of computing, everyone had their own ideas about which binary code should refer to which text characters, there was no universal standard saying 01100001 = a, 01100010 = b, etc., but this was in the 1980s Changed with the formation of Unicode.
